Circular No.: 169/01/2022-GST
Date of Circular: 12th March 2022
Relevant Sections and Rules:
- CGST Act, 2017:
- Section 73 and Section 74: Determination of tax not paid/short paid or erroneously refunded
- Section 168(1): Power to issue instructions
- IGST Act, 2017:
- Section 20 read with CGST provisions (applicable mutatis mutandis)
- Notifications Referenced:
- Notification No. 2/2017 – CT dated 19.06.2017
- Notification No. 02/2022 – CT dated 11.03.2022
- Circular Amended:
- Circular No. 31/05/2018-GST dated 9th February 2018
Summary of Clarification Provided:
- Empowerment of All-India Jurisdiction to Additional/Joint Commissioners for Adjudication of DGGI SCNs:
With the insertion of Para 3A in Notification No. 2/2017–CT via Notification No. 02/2022–CT, Additional and Joint Commissioners of Central Tax in certain specified Commissionerates have been empowered with all-India jurisdiction to adjudicate show cause notices (SCNs) issued by the Directorate General of GST Intelligence (DGGI).
Accordingly, Paras 6 and 7 of Circular No. 31/05/2018 have been amended. - Amended Para 6 – SCNs by Audit Commissionerates and DGGI:
Officers of Audit Commissionerates and DGGI shall continue to issue SCNs only, without adjudication power.
- Where the noticee is registered in only one Executive Commissionerate, the SCN will be adjudicated by a competent officer in that jurisdiction.
- Amended Para 7.1 – Multijurisdictional SCNs by DGGI:
Where SCNs by DGGI involve:
- Multiple Commissionerates, or
- Same PAN but different GSTINs under various jurisdictions,
→ they will be adjudicated by one of the empowered Additional/Joint Commissioners having All-India jurisdiction as per Notification No. 02/2022–CT.
A tabular list of jurisdiction-wise adjudicating Commissionerates is provided (e.g., Delhi North for Delhi zone, Kolkata North for Kolkata zone, etc.).
- Amended Para 7.2 – SCNs by Audit Officers Involving Multiple Jurisdictions:
In such cases, a proposal must be sent to the Board for appointment of a common adjudicating authority. - Amended Para 7.3 – Past SCNs Issued by DGGI Before 11.03.2022:
If such SCNs (falling under Para 7.1 scope) were issued before 11.03.2022 and no adjudication has yet occurred, they can be made answerable to the appropriate All-India jurisdictional officer by issuing a corrigendum.
